Product Overview

Chatterbug
Chatterbug

Description: Chatterbug is a language learning app that focuses on building conversation skills. It matches learners with native speaker coaches for 30 minute video chat sessions to practice speaking in real-world situations.

Hope Speak
Hope Speak

Description: Hope Speak is an open source web application that provides easy access to speaking aids and communication devices for people with disabilities. It includes text-to-speech, word prediction, and other accessibility features.
